On 7 January 2024, I purchased a shore excursion on the Queen Anne, sailing in June 2024 to the Norwegian fjords. The day after I made the purchase, I noticed that my credit card had been double-billed for the amount. I contacted Cunard (UK) by phone, and the agent promised to forward the request for repayment to the finance office. She said to expect a response in five to seven business days.  Nothing happened. On 22 January, I spoke with Cunard again, and the agent said that she would expedite the request.  Still nothing has happened. I'm not sure what else I should do or whom I should contact.

Speak to one’s credit card company, requesting a Section 75, with full explanation why to CC.

The CC will reverse the erroneous payment.
